CVE-2008-4811: The _expand_quoted_text function in libs/Smarty_Compiler.class.php in Smarty 2.6.20 r2797 and earlier allow...

The _expand_quoted_text function in libs/Smarty_Compiler.class.php in Smarty 2.6.20 r2797 and earlier all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ary PHP code via vectors related to templates and a \ (backslash) before a dollar-sign character.

CVE-2008-4811 is a Smarty template engine flaw that can let a remote attacker cause arbitrary PHP code execution in affected deployments. The business risk is highest where old Smarty versions process templates that users or administrators can edit through an application. Exposure is likely limited to legacy PHP applications using Smarty 2.6.20 r2797 or earlier, including products that bundled Smarty internally. Internet exposure depends on whether attackers can influence template content or trigger compilation through application features. Treat as a priority legacy exposure review, especially for public PHP applications. It is not proven actively exploited in the supplied sources, but arbitrary PHP execution can become severe when template control is reachable. Mitigation focus: Inventory applications and dependencies for Smarty 2.6.20 r2797 or earlier.; Follow Smarty, distribution, or Debian DSA-1691 guidance for corrected packages.; Remove untrusted access to template creation, editing, or upload paths..
